Silver prices decline 7% in a day
Open interest falls nearly 20 per cent on profit booking. Silver prices crashed by Rs 5,150 a kg in Mumbai market after rising to an all-time high yesterday on profit booking. Even in futures market, there was heavy profit booking as the contract will expire next week. Open interest fell nearly 20 per cent in a day showing the extent of profit booking.
